An Ethnographic Study Of First-Generation Alumni At Dartmouth College: Perspectives From Alumni, Faculty, Staff, And Administrators, Brittney A. Roden
An Ethnographic Study Of First-Generation Alumni At Dartmouth College: Perspectives From Alumni, Faculty, Staff, And Administrators, Brittney A. Roden
Dartmouth College Master’s Theses
First- generation college students (FGCS) often face challenges adapting to the academic and social environments of elite institutions like Dartmouth College. Lacking familial experience in higher education, they must decode unspoken institutional norms, contributing to stress, social isolation, and barriers to accessing institutional support. This study examines how FGCS experience academic pressure, social belonging, and engagement with campus systems, and how these shape their personal and professional trajectories. Drawing on participant-generated audio diary journals with alumni, qualitative interviews with faculty and staff, and a review of existing literature, this research highlights the interplay of academic stress, coping strategies, cultural capital, …

Kindergarten Through Third-Grade Teachers’ Experiences With State-Level Literacy Coaching Support: A Phenomenological Qualitative Research Study, Nicole Hunter
Theses and Dissertations
This phenomenological qualitative applied dissertation was designed to provide insight into the experiences of kindergarten through third-grade general education teachers when supported by state-level literacy coaches. State-level literacy coaches are assigned to specific elementary schools and offer embedded professional development and professional learning opportunities to enhance literacy instruction and promote professional growth among elementary teachers. Although many kindergarten through third-grade general education teachers in literacy support schools see state-level coaching support as beneficial, some teachers deem this support as punitive and are reluctant to collaborate with coaches.
Teachers' experiences with literacy coaches have been viewed as a component in the …

Screen Time Use, Reading Achievement, And Thinking Maps: A Correlational Study Of Fifth-Grade Students, Morgan Brooke Unger
Screen Time Use, Reading Achievement, And Thinking Maps: A Correlational Study Of Fifth-Grade Students, Morgan Brooke Unger
Theses and Dissertations
The problem addressed in this study was the fixation of screen time among fifth-grade students at a kindergarten to Grade 12 private school in South Florida. By the time children reach age 12, 69% of adolescents own a smartphone. The purpose of this study was designed to determine (a) the relationship between screen time use and reading achievement among fifth graders, (b) the relationship between parents’ awareness of their child’s screen time use and their child’s actual screen time use, and (c) how well fifth-grade students’ Thinking Maps illustrate the problems associated with screen time fixation at a kindergarten to …

Regulation Of Private Higher Education In Mexico: How Non-Elite Institutions Navigate Authorization, Edson Eduardo Navarro Meza
Regulation Of Private Higher Education In Mexico: How Non-Elite Institutions Navigate Authorization, Edson Eduardo Navarro Meza
Electronic Theses & Dissertations (2024 - present)
Low quality, excessive commercialization, fraud, profit in disguise, and predatory dynamics remain the most pressing regulatory challenges in the context of private higher education in Mexico. These problems have been largely attributed to the ineffectiveness of authorization mechanisms, which have repeatedly become the focus of controversy and criticism from social, academic, and media sectors regarding their role in shaping the development of the sector. Some observers blame the government for its inaction in the face of rapid institutional proliferation, as well as for maintaining authorization procedures that have proven to be ineffective gatekeepers of sectoral expansion. Twelve Tips For Using Microlearning For Faculty Development, Kylie Fitzgerald, Brett Vaughan, Tamara Clements, Svetlana King, Alison Ledger, Kate Mathews, Rosalind Norton, Michael Poulton, Rosie Shea, Rashmi Watson, Walter Eppich, Stephen Trumble, Marco De Carvalho Filho
Twelve Tips For Using Microlearning For Faculty Development, Kylie Fitzgerald, Brett Vaughan, Tamara Clements, Svetlana King, Alison Ledger, Kate Mathews, Rosalind Norton, Michael Poulton, Rosie Shea, Rashmi Watson, Walter Eppich, Stephen Trumble, Marco De Carvalho Filho
Research outputs 2022 to 2026
Teaching is an expected as part of the health professional’s role, amidst clinical and administrative workloads, yet many receive limited education training. Microlearning addresses this gap through short, focused, flexible learning units integrated into daily workflows for immediate application. Our paper presents twelve practical tips to guide faculty developers to design, implement, evaluate and sustain microlearning programs for faculty development (FD). The tips offer ideas to help faculty developers manage common barriers to engagement (i.e. time, relevance, technology, institutional support) and provide ideas to navigate these. Unlocking Students’ Creative Confidence Through Design Thinking Practices: A Parallel Mediation Of Collaboration And Diversity, And Creativity, Faisal Iddris, Agyapong, Emmanuel Mensah Kparl, Philip Opoku Mensah
Unlocking Students’ Creative Confidence Through Design Thinking Practices: A Parallel Mediation Of Collaboration And Diversity, And Creativity, Faisal Iddris, Agyapong, Emmanuel Mensah Kparl, Philip Opoku Mensah
Research outputs 2022 to 2026
Despite the consensus in the literature that design thinking practices spark innovation, research has yet to examine the creative confidence outcomes of design thinking practices. Integrating the Resource-Based Theory and the Componential Theory of Creativity, we hypothesised a parallel mediation model in which design thinking practices are associated with creative confidence via collaboration and diversity, and creativity. Based on a sample of 419 tertiary students in a Ghanaian University, it was found that design thinking facilitates students’ creative confidence. Also, collaboration and diversity partially mediate the relationship between design thinking and creative confidence. The study also found support for the …
